Smoke Hangs Over State as Warm Trend Builds This Week
Storms moved through parts of Minnesota yesterday, bringing heavy rain and hail as a cold front swept across the state. Behind the front, areas of smoke are expected to drift in, carried by the jet stream. Temperatures will stay mild through the week, with highs in the mid to upper 70s. Another chance of rain arrives Friday and could linger into early next week, so outdoor plans may need a backup. While the pattern looks active heading into the peak of severe weather season, no severe threats are currently expected.
